I kid you not, I had my winter tires installed last week on my Ranger.
The tires obviously were in the bed.
While looking through the window in the waiting room at my truck in the garage, I saw the mechanic open the tailgate and he was taken aback by the damper action on it LOL
He kept nodding in approval and called another mechanic to show him my truck.
That was worth the cost of my damper right there!!!

BTW, the real reason for me to have the damper is because of my bum knees from 30 years of hard laboring. I can get in the bed with the tailgate closed but not hopping on it when open. (Age has taken a toll)
So I climb in the truck, open the tailgate from inside the bed and don't have to hear that bang when letting it drop. I just sit and exit when I get out.
Love it!
